David L. "Dutch" Baumeister, age 62, longtime Paxton resident, died February 25, 2009 at his home.

David was born July 23, 1946 at Lynch, NE., to Louis and Alma (Emme) Baumeister. He attended country school in Boyd County, NE., west of the family farm near Butte, NE.

David graduated from Butte Public High School in 1964. He was drafted into the US Army in January 1966 and was stationed at Fort Hood, TX. He was honorably discharged in 1968.

On July 23, 1969 David married Joann E. Frasch at Burke, SD. The couple made their first home in Butte, NE. where David worked for Schoetlin Oil Co. They moved to Gregory, SD. where he worked for McMeen Allis Chalmers dealership as a mechanic.

They then moved to Jamison, NE. where they had a Purina feed business and hog operation. They moved to Joann's parents' farm near Herrick, SD where they farmed and ranched.

After this they moved back to Jamison and David worked for the Kaupp Brothers ranch. In 1975 they moved to Orchard, NE where he worked for Circle Eight Farming and in 1979 was transferred to Paxton, NE.

After they discontinued business he worked for Faulks Pipe Company. He also was employed at Spurgin Inc. before becoming the Utility Superintendent for the Village of Paxton in 1988 until his health failed. The couple also owned and operated the West Side apartments in Paxton.

David was a member of the Paxton American Legion and a member of the Nebraska Rod and Classic Car Association along with his wife Joann.

His hobbies include fishing, boating, restoring and driving classic cars with Joann, attending classic car shows, caring for his lawn and garden, designing and building additions for their home and collecting 1/18 die cast classic cars. He loved playing country music on his guitar until arthritis caused him to quit. He enjoyed listening to classic country music and watching old western movies. David was an avid Nebraska Cornhusker fan.
